Today when I started to computer the icons were at least 3X the size they usually are and the graphics on my wallpaper and online where very grainy.  I did GET an error message on startup (once out of the 3 times I RESTARTED).  It was "there is a problem with your display settings.  The adapter type is incorrect or the current settings do not work with your hardware".   I reset the display settings and it helped a bit, but things still aren't great.   I have no idea what this means.  I would appreciate any suggestions.Videocard drivers need reinstalling.

How have they become corrupted? What have you done?This is probably a stupid question, but how do I do that?  I checked for UPDATES on the Microsoft site and there were no current updates available.Remove the video CARD from your device manager.

Right click My Computer>Properties>Hardware>Device Manager.

Re-boot & allow Windows to detect your video card & install the drivers for you.

If you feel adventurous you can also download & install the latest drivers from the manufacturer's website. Quote

Thanks for your help.  I actually got it figured out.  It was in the settings after all.  I had the colour set to 252 colours, and I reset it to 16 bit and now it is fine.
